Aerodynamic force characteristics and galloping analysis of iced bundled conductors

Wind and Structures, 2014
Aerodynamic characteristics of crescent and D-shape bundled conductors were measured by high frequency force balance technique in the wind tunnel. The drag and lift coefficients of each sub-conductor and the whole bundled conductors were presented under various attack angles of wind. Effects of urging by the rider on gallop stride characteristics of quarter horses

Journal of Equine Veterinary Science, 1988
Summary The effects of urging by the rider on the limb contact patterns of the gallop stride were documented using high-speed cinematography. The subjects were 4 Quarter Horse fillies, approximately 30 months old, that were raised, housed, fed and trained alike.
